This print showcases "The Armorial Bearings of Edward Chaddock Lowndes, Esquire of Castle Combe, Chippenham". Created by an anonymous English School artist in the 20th century, this color lithograph is a part of a private collection. The artwork was originally featured as an illustration for "The Art of Heraldry" by Arthur Charles Fox-Davies in 1904.
